Commodore Stockton proclaimed governor......Aug. 17, 1846 Mexicans recapture Los Angeles......Sept. 29-30, 1846 Gen. Stephen W. Kearny, under orders from Washington to proceed from New Mexico to California and establish a provisional government, arrives at Santa Maria......Dec. 5, 1846 Indecisive battle at San Pascual between Mexican Gen. Don Andres Pico, and General Kearny, who is twice wounded......Dec. 6, 1846 Battle of San Gabriel; decisive defeat of the Mexicans......Jan. 8-9, 1847 Los Angeles regained by the Americans......Jan. 10, 1847 Colonel Fremont assumes the civil government under commission from Commodore Stockton......Jan. 19, 1847 General Kearny, under instructions from the President, issues a proclamation from Monterey as governor, and directs Colonel Fremont to deliver in person, at Monterey, all public documents in his charge, which he does with hesitation......March 1, 1847 Col.
